A computer simulation code was developed to estimate the temperatures in and around a geothermal well.
This code is employing explicit solution method to solve finite difference equations on transient heat transfer problems, and is applicable for three types of fluid flow in the wellbore; injection, production and circulation.
A water circulation test was performed in HY-2 Well located in Yakedake area, Gifu Prefecture, to get field data for the evaluation of the computer simulation code.
Comparisons of computed results were made with the exact solution and field data obtained. These results showed that this simulation code can simulate the temperature in and around the borehole satisfactorily.
